What am I Getting When I Pay for a California Bankruptcy Attorney?

With bankruptcies across the country at record levels, the demand for experienced and effective bankruptcy attorneys has risen as well. This demand has also opened the door for shops which present themselves as attorney-driven bankruptcy firms but actually function as document processors with little interest in delivering benefits to their clients. These types of shops typically advertise as discounters, trying to win business on price alone. To that end, hiring representation for a bankruptcy proceeding is literally a “get what you pay for” situation with wide range of potential outcomes.

These different outcomes depend on what the firm is actually doing in the bankruptcy case, whether an attorney is actually handling the case, and the wherewithal of the bankruptcy attorney to achieve the highest level of benefits for the client.      

Before interviewing for a bankruptcy attorney, it is important to know what to expect from your attorney during the bankruptcy process. The actions provided by your bankruptcy attorney should include:

  • The attorney will first work to get a complete understanding of your financial circumstances.
  • By understanding your personal situation, the attorney will then work to determine whether filing for bankruptcy provides the best solution versus other forms of debt relief.
  •  If bankruptcy is found to be the best option, the bankruptcy attorney will then determine whether a Chapter 7 or a Chapter 13 will provide the best outcome.
  • If a Chapter 7 filing is found to be the best solution, the attorney will provide assistance with the means test to ensure eligibility.
  • A qualified bankruptcy attorney will make sure that the case is conducted in accordance with state and federal laws with all documents completed and submitted according to court protocols.
  • The attorney will make sure that everything is done to maximize your outcome whether the situation calls for lien stripping, auto loan cram downs, the complete discharge of unsecured debts, and a host of other benefits as provided by the bankruptcy code.
  • A bankruptcy attorney will accompany you to creditor meetings.
  • Finally, a bankruptcy lawyer will represent your interests to the fullest extent possible in bankruptcy court.

Paying for the services of a highly qualified and effective California bankruptcy attorney is likely to cost more than engaging the services of a bankruptcy shop. The end result of quality representation is well worth the added up front expense considering the value of benefits achieved in the process, which can be worth many thousands of dollars in your pocket.
